#650eb4 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#650eb4 is composed of 39.6% red, 5.5% green and 70.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 43.9% cyan, 92.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 29.4% black. It has a hue angle of 271.4 degrees, a saturation of 85.6% and a lightness of 38%. #650eb4 color hex could be obtained by blending #ca1cff with #000069. Closest websafe color is: #6600cc.

Shades and Tints of #650eb4

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090110 is the darkest color, while #fefdff is the lightest one.

Tones of #650eb4

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#616062 is the less saturated color, while #6507bb is the most saturated one.
